idealism
n[U]
1 forming,pursuing or believing in ideals (ideal n 2), esp unrealistically理想主义(尤指不切实际地追求或信奉的理想)
Idealism has no place in modern politics. 在当代政治生活中, 理想主义根本行不通.
2 (esp in art and literature) imaginative treatment of objects or ideas in an ideal and often unrealistic way (尤指文艺方面的)观念主义(以理想的、 常为不现实的方法对待事物或思想). Cf 参看 classicism, romanticism (romantic).
3 (philosophy 哲) belief that ideas are the only things that are real or about which we can know anything 唯心论; 观念论; 理念论. Cf 参看 realism.
